#e85809 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e85809 is composed of 91% red, 34.5% green and 3.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 62.1% magenta, 96.1% yellow and 9% black. It has a hue angle of 21.3 degrees, a saturation of 92.5% and a lightness of 47.3%. #e85809 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ffb012 with #d10000. Closest websafe color is: #ff6600.

#e85809 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e85809 has RGB values of R:232, G:88, B:9 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.62, Y:0.96, K:0.09. Its decimal value is 15226889.

Shades and Tints of #e85809
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050200 is the darkest color, while #fef6f2 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e85809
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#797878 is the less saturated color, while #e85809 is the most saturated one.
